Transaction 73c21250dbd653480c56791dbab5e47f6cefb1a827c23b51f6b4a3fdd3424216
2 Input
2 Outputs
- 73c21250dbd653480c56791dbab5e47f6cefb1a827c23b51f6b4a3fdd3424216:0
- 73c21250dbd653480c56791dbab5e47f6cefb1a827c23b51f6b4a3fdd3424216:1
value 2883983
address 13hAvrDr7S2qq8y9N6kcDD6AzAPUogrE8T
value 32723302
address 1ALHSKiBHQTPk1FqfL6wFix3Ssdbr5vd1j